React Native Development

Our team at NextGen specializes in creating high-quality mobile applications using React Native, a powerful and versatile framework. With a dedicated team of React Native experts, the company excels in delivering cross-platform applications that offer a seamless user experience on both iOS and Android devices.

Developing a React Native application in collaboration with a client involves a series of well-defined steps to ensure a successful project. Here's a detailed breakdown of the process:


1. Client Training (Optional)

If needed, we provide training and documentation for the client's team to manage and update the app's content or address minor issues without external assistance.

2. Conceptualization and Wireframing

We collaborate with the client to conceptualize the app's features, functionality, and user interface design. This phase often includes the creation of wireframes or prototypes to provide a visual representation of the app's layout and design.

3. Design and Development

With the design approved, the development phase begins. Our skilled React Native developers work on creating the app, leveraging a single codebase that will run on both iOS and Android. This ensures consistency across platforms.

4. Testing and Quality Assurance:

We rigorously test the app to identify and rectify any bugs, issues, or glitches. This includes functional testing, usability testing, and performance testing to ensure a smooth and responsive user experience.

5. App Deployment to App Stores

After the client approves the final product, we assist in preparing the app for submission to the Apple App Store and Google Play Store, ensuring it meets the respective platform's guidelines and requirements.

6. Client Consultation and Requirement Gathering

The process begins with a comprehensive consultation with the client. In this phase, the development team at NextGen Software collaborates with the client to understand their app idea, business objectives, target audience, and specific requirements. This step is crucial for establishing a clear project scope.

7. Post-Launch Support and Maintenance

We offer post-launch support and maintenance services to address any issues, updates, or enhancements. This ensures the app remains secure and up-to-date.

8. Project Plan and Timeline Development

We create a project plan that includes timelines, milestones, and budget estimates. This roadmap provides a clear structure for the project's development and helps manage client expectations.

9. Regular Client Updates and Feedback

We maintain transparent communication with the client throughout the development process. Regular meetings are held to review the app's progress, provide updates, and gather feedback, allowing the client to actively participate in shaping the final product.

10. Client Acceptance Testing (CAT)

We invite the client to conduct acceptance testing to ensure the app meets their expectations and functions correctly. Any final adjustments are made based on their feedback.

11. Technology Stack and Framework Selection

We decide on the technology stack and framework for the React Native app. Our team helps the client understand the advantages of using React Native, such as code reusability and cost-effectiveness.

By following this structured process, NextGen Software ensures that clients receive a top-notch React Native application that aligns with their goals, engages their target audience, and offers a seamless cross-platform experience. Our client-centric approach and commitment to quality makes us a trusted partner for businesses and individuals seeking excellence in mobile app development with React Native.


Technologies we work with:

Questions & Answers

Some common questions

  • Our Experience

  • Our Approach

  • Security and Post-Launch

  • Our Pricing

Let’s team up to bring your project to life


brand-logo